Texas Instruments designs, manufactures, and sells semiconductors for electronics designers and manufacturers. It operates through an Analog segment (power, signal-chain, sensing, and lighting products) and an Embedded Processing segment (microcontrollers, digital signal processors, and applications processors) used across industrial, automotive, communications, and other electronics markets.

Understand Texas Instruments Incorporated: how it makes money

Texas Instruments designs, manufactures, and sells semiconductors to electronics designers and manufacturers worldwide, earning revenue from its Analog product lines (power management, signal chain, and related components) and Embedded Processing product lines (embedded processing for electronics).

Its profit model is driven by selling semiconductor content through two product platforms, Analog and Embedded Processing, where revenue comes from product demand by electronics designers and manufacturers and the gross profit converts those sales into margin.
